I had to go through it a bit with the local dealerships here. I had a slave clutch cylinder go bad and they wanted to get me to put both units in but I had done the master about a year prior. They insisted that it must be done and then wanted to charge me a ton to do just the slave. Well I politely called the Beaverton dealership while at the local one and got a great price on the part and after the local guys realized that I had options with other dealerships they started to act right. I still go through Beaverton and Courtesy for parts though. I have become friends with the master mechanic at one of the local dealerships and he gave me some great tips and "extras" when I did take the car in. In fact he wants to start a local car club!! He's custom building a 240SX with a lot of different components (Z31 turbo) etc... I also now have access to a lot of additional expertise and information that I never had before. Bottom line is that you need to talk to the mechanic that is working on your car a few times and let him/her know you're not a dummy or an A..Ho.. and they will tend to be helpful.
